Crockpot Green Beans Recipe

Description

These Crockpot Green Beans are a simple and delicious side dish that’s perfect for any occasion. Fresh green beans are slow-cooked with onions, garlic, parmesan, bacon, and chicken broth, resulting in tender, flavorful beans that require minimal effort. It’s a comforting and easy way to add a healthy vegetable to your meal.


Ingredients

Units Scale
  • 2 pounds fresh green beans, washed and trimmed
  • 1 cup on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 3 tablespoons parmesan cheese, grated
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 6 slices bacon, cooked crisp and crumbled
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Combine Ingredients: Add the diced onion, minced garlic, grated parmesan cheese, crumbled bacon, chicken broth, and fresh green beans to a 4-quart slow cooker.
  2. Season: Season with salt and pepper as desired.
  3. Cook: Place the lid on top and cook on high for 2-3 hours, or until the green beans are tender.
  4. Serve: You may remove some of the broth before serving and add more crumbled bacon and parmesan if desired.

Notes

  • Adjust the cooking time based on your preferred tenderness of the green beans.
  • For a smoky flavor, use smoked bacon.
  • Add other seasonings like red pepper flakes or Italian seasoning for variety.
  • You can use turkey bacon as a substitute for pork bacon.
  • For a creamier dish, add a dollop of butter or a splash of heavy cream before serving.
